What does a programming manager do?

The duties of a programming manager vary significantly depending on the industry in which they work. For example, a programming manager who works for a museum or conference center plans the schedule of events and content for conventions, group visits, recreation, and educational initiatives. A programming manager in the music or TV industry plans content such as event coverage based on broadcast length, time available, and community needs in collaboration with other professionals who prepare the programming schedule. An IT programming manager has more project management responsibilities with a broader scope, including directing multiple application projects and initiatives from a high-level perspective.

Confluent Medical Technologies is dedicated to working collaboratively with our customers, taking projects from rapid prototype into high volume production. Our unparalleled technical expertise, proven experience and partnership with our clients has allowed us to perfect the process necessary to deliver world-class medical devices through innovative material science, engineering and manufacturing. Our primary capabilities include: Nitinol components, catheters, delivery systems, biomedical textiles, access kits, and guidewires. We take pride in our position as the leader in the medical technology space and are driven by a passion to create products that our clients have envisioned for their customers.

We are looking for a Manager, Engineering to join our Austin, TX team! As a uniquely qualified candidate, you will:

  • Manage, mentor and provide career development support to team of Engineers and Technicians
  • Assign engineering resources to project teams and ensure on-time completion of technical activities.
  • Be responsible for process development โ€“ from initial development to sustained manufacturing validation, planning, directing, and coordinating engineering activities, studies and programs in support of new product development.
  • Be responsible for planning, executing and supervising process development related to catheter development from project early phase development and initial low volume builds in Austin through transfer to Costa Rica for long-term high-volume manufacturing.
  • Responsible for ensuring that manufacturing processes are developed to meet long-term manufacturing goals and cost targets outlined in the project business case.
  • Be responsible for process identification, parameter optimization, proof of concept testing, technology improvements, and process implementation.
  • Be responsible for tool, fixture, and equipment design and qualification used for manufacturing medical devices and components.
  • Provide critical input for design and build of equipment required for processing catheters.
  • Support and provide equipment guidelines and tooling modifications for process improvements.
  • Be responsible for screening and optimization of process parameters to achieve robust and stable processes and maximize yields, efficiencies and process capabilities.
  • Be responsible for documentation of studies in engineering memorandums and work instructions.
  • Identify and investigate and develop new technologies for catheter processing.
  • Create clear and concise Medical Device File (MDF) documentation to manufacture complex catheter assemblies.
  • Help train pilot production technicians, manufacturing operators, and transfer engineers in the assembly techniques, inspection methods and required documentation.
  • Optimize processes to meet manufacturing quality controls, build time, cost, yield targets.
  • Generate clear and concise work instructions, test methods, and visual standards.
  • Design and perform Process Characterization Studyโ€™s & DOEโ€™s, support protocols and reports.
  • Have a firm understanding of validation strategy (IQ/OQ/PQ), support protocols and reports.
  • Be responsible for team budget and capital appropriation based on sound testing and demonstrated feasibility.
Education and Experience
  • BS degree in a relevant discipline and 12 or more years of related engineering and management experience.
  • Or: MS degree and 8 or more years of related experience.
  • Or: Ph.D. and 6 or more years of related experience.
  • Experience in the medical device industry.
  • 2+ years of leadership and people management experience.
  • Six Sigma Black Belt preferred.
  • Possess excellent English communication skills โ€“ both written and oral.
  • Hands-on experience with a variety of catheter production equipment, such as: hot boxes, die-bonders, braiders, coil winders, laminators, ovens, UV adhesive light welders, laser welders, and others.
  • Strong understanding of materials typical to catheter production: Pebax, Nylon, Polyurethanes, PEEK, PTFE, FEP, CA and UV adhesives, Stainless steel, NiTi, etc.
  • Strong overall knowledge of entire field of work, complex level engineering experience.
  • Familiar with technical literature and standards related to area of expertise.
  • Extensive hands-on experience.
  • Leadership and people management experience.
  • Attention to detail, professional attitude, team player.
